
Search by job, company or skills
Role Overview
We are looking for a Development Manager who will bring structure, rigour, and technical depth to how we build our AI products. This is a role for someone who is as comfortable deep in system design and architecture decisions as they are running a sprint, reviewing code, and shaping engineering culture. You will lead the development of Kanerika's AI products — solutions at the intersection of data analytics and enterprise software — working alongside a team of intelligent, high-energy engineers who set a high bar for themselves. We want a builder-leader — someone who brings structured thinking to product development, keeps the team sharp and focused, and is genuinely excited about where AI is taking enterprise software.
Key Responsibilities
Structured Product Development
• Establish and drive a structured, repeatable approach to product development across Kanerika's AI product portfolio — covering planning, architecture, sprint execution, and release discipline.
• Own the end-to-end development lifecycle: from requirements and system design through build, test, deployment, and continuous improvement.
• Introduce and enforce engineering best practices — code quality, documentation standards, design reviews, and testing frameworks — that scale with the team and the products.
• Bring clarity and predictability to delivery without sacrificing the team's pace and engineering ambition. Technical Leadership & System Design
• Lead system design and architecture decisions for AI-powered product features — ensuring solutions are scalable, cost-efficient, and built for the long term.
• Drive cost optimisation strategies for AI features, including model selection, inference efficiency, caching strategies, and smart resource allocation.
• Conduct meaningful code and design reviews — setting a high technical bar while helping the team grow through constructive, experience-backed feedback.
• Identify technical risks early and make clear, well-reasoned calls on trade-offs across build quality, speed, and scalability. AI-Savvy Development Practices
• Champion best practices for AI-based product development — including responsible LLM integration, prompt engineering governance, hallucination mitigation, evaluation frameworks, and AI observability.
• Guide the team in making pragmatic decisions around AI adoption: when to build, when to buy, and how to integrate third-party AI capabilities cleanly into product architecture.
• Stay ahead of evolving AI tooling, frameworks, and patterns — bringing relevant ideas and approaches back to the team proactively.
Team & Delivery
• Lead a team of intelligent and highly capable engineers — your role is to amplify their output, not manage their time.
• Run effective sprint planning, retrospectives, and delivery cycles — keeping the team focused, unblocked, and aligned to product priorities.
• Work closely with the Product Leader to translate the product roadmap into well-scoped, executable development plans; provide regular progress updates and proactively surface risk factors, dependencies, and blockers before they impact delivery. • Foster a culture of ownership, curiosity, and continuous learning — where engineers feel challenged and take pride in what they ship.
Required Qualifications
Experience Technical Skills
• 10–12 years of overall experience in software or product development, with a strong hands-on engineering background throughout.
• At least 3 years of experience leading a development team — with a track record of shipping well engineered, production-grade software.
• Demonstrated experience building structured development processes in fast-paced, product-driven environments.
• Prior experience working on or alongside AI-integrated products — whether LLM-based features, ML pipelines, or intelligent automation — is an advantage.
• Strong hands-on proficiency in Java for backend development; working knowledge of Python, particularly for AI/ML integration and data processing workflows.
• Solid understanding of system design principles — including distributed systems, API design, data modelling, and scalability patterns.
• Good hands-on experience with AI/LLM integration patterns, prompt engineering, cost optimisation in AI workloads, and responsible AI practices in product development. • Good understanding of DevOps best practices — including CI/CD pipelines, version control workflows, containerisation, automated testing, and release management.
• Exposure to cloud platforms (Azure preferred) and modern SaaS architecture patterns. • Hands-on experience integrating LLMs, AI agents, or conversational AI capabilities into enterprise SaaS products.
Mindset & Soft Skills
• A structured thinker who brings process and clarity to ambiguous, fast-moving development environments.
• A genuine problem solver — someone who enjoys untangling complexity and finds clean, well reasoned solutions.
• Eager to learn — intellectually curious and excited about staying current with emerging technologies, especially in AI.
• Clear communicator who can translate technical decisions into language that resonates with both engineers and product leadership. Leads by example — sets the engineering standard through the quality of their own thinking, not just
Good to have
• Familiarity with Microsoft Fabric, Azure OpenAI, or similar AI/data platform services.
• Experience with cost optimisation strategies specific to AI inference — token management, model routing, caching, and latency reduction.
• Knowledge of observability and monitoring practices for AI-powered applications.
• Exposure to data analytics, BI, or agentic AI product development.
What you will Build
Your primary focus will be leading the development of Kanerika's AI products — solutions built around enterprise data analytics, conversational AI, and intelligent automation. You will work on products that enable natural language querying of complex enterprise data, surface insights in seconds, and deliver governed, source-traced answers across diverse data sources. You will shape how these products are architected, how AI capabilities are integrated responsibly and efficiently, and how the engineering team delivers with consistency and quality as the portfolio evolves. Education • Bachelor's Degree in Computer Science, Engineering, Information Systems, or related field.
Job ID: 148679263
We don’t charge any money for job offers